EV Backers Eye Senate Tax Plans As Panels Write Reconciliation Bill

September 1, 2021
With the House Ways & Means Committee in the coming weeks poised to mark up extensions to clean energy tax credits as part of its portion of Democrats’ budget “reconciliation” package, observers are questioning how lawmakers will reconcile House and Senate approaches on electric vehicle (EV)-related credits. On the high-profile issue of EV purchase incentives, for example, electrification supporters favor part of a Senate plan that could offer incentives to more vehicles from a single automaker than existing House approaches...
